Instead of distributing these functions across multiple systems, climatechfacade (CTF) handles thermal performance where it occurs – at the facade.
Thermal loads are handled at the facade – not inside the building.
The climatechfacade (CTF) integrates heating, cooling and solar shading directly into the building envelope. Instead of distributing these functions across multiple systems, CTF handles thermal performance where it occurs – at the facade.

CTF uses existing heating and cooling circuits and manages thermal energy directly within the facade before it enters the building.
No distribution across the building.
No delayed response.

Each CTF module is a prefabricated facade element with integrated heating, cooling and shading system components.
energy is delivered via controlled surface temperature

Is climatechfacade more cost-effective than a traditional facade with separate HVAC and shading systems?
Yes. climatechfacade combines heating, cooling and solar shading in a single facade system. By reducing technical interfaces, coordination effort and duplicated building services infrastructure, projects can lower lifecycle costs while simplifying execution.
Can CTF connect to existing heating and cooling systems?
Yes. Climatechfacade can connect to existing heating and cooling networks and works alongside established building services infrastructure.
Is climatechfacade a proven technology?
Yes. climatechfacade is built using established facade, heating, cooling and control technologies. The innovation comes from integrating these functions into a single coordinated facade system.
